Tennessee Congressional District 5
Four candidates are on the November 3 ballot, including two independents.
On the ballot in Benton, Dyer, Henry, Hickman, Houston, Humphreys, Lake, Lauderdale, Lewis, Maury, Montgomery, Obion, Shelby, Stewart, Tipton, Weakley and Williamson Counties.
On the November 3, 2026 ballot
- Charlie HatcherRepublican
Won the Republican primary with 53.2% of the vote (36,544 votes), ahead of Andy Ogles at 46.8%. Of College Grove. Full primary results
- Chaz MolderDemocratic
Won the Democratic primary with 40.5% of the vote (17,729 votes), ahead of Yolanda Cooper-Sutton at 32.8%. Of Columbia. Full primary results
- James A. JohnsonIndependent
Qualified by petition as an independent from Memphis. Independents do not run in a primary.
- Micheál (Me-Haul) O'LearyIndependent
Qualified by petition as an independent from Nashville. Independents do not run in a primary.
